What is a Throttle Body?
The throttle body is a part of the air intake system in a car's engine that controls the amount of air entering the engine. It is usually located between the air filter and the intake manifold and consists of a butterfly valve that opens and closes based on the driver's input via the accelerator pedal. By controlling the airflow, the throttle body helps in maintaining the proper air-fuel mixture for combustion in the engine cylinders.

How the Charging System Works:
When the engine is running, the alternator is turned by a belt connected to the engine crankshaft. As the alternator spins, it generates electrical energy through the process of electromagnetic induction. This energy is converted into direct current (DC) by diodes in the alternator and is used to charge the battery and power the electrical systems in the vehicle.

Common Charging System Issues:
The charging system in a vehicle can experience various issues that may affect its performance. Some common problems include a faulty alternator, worn-out drive belt, corroded battery terminals, or a defective voltage regulator. Signs of a failing charging system include dim headlights, a dead battery, warning lights on the dashboard, and difficulty starting the vehicle.
